Woody Platt is a Grammy Award-winning bluegrass singer, songwriter, guitarist, and a founding member of the Steep Canyon Rangers. Platt has won awards, collaborated with the likes of Del McCoury and Steve Martin, and been inducted into the North Carolina Music Hall of Fame.
Dobro master and 14-time Grammy winner Jerry Douglas is to the resonator guitar what Jimi Hendrix was to the electric guitar: elevating, transforming, and continuously reinventing the instrument in countless ways. Douglas is a freewheeling, forward-thinking recording and touring artist whose output incorporates country, bluegrass, rock, jazz, blues, and Celtic elements into his distinctive musical vision.
Barry Bales is a legendary bluegrass and country double bassist, songwriter, and producer who has performed and recorded with Alison Krauss and Union Station for over 30 years. As an in-demand session, musician Barry has recorded with some of the biggest bluegrass and country music stars, including Dolly Parton, Reba McEntire, Susan Ashton, Dwight Yoakam, Merle Haggard, Vince Gill, Willie Nelson, and The Cox Family, as well as on many movie soundtracks such as “O Brother, Where Out Thou?”.
Buddy Melton is an award-winning fiddle player, singer, and founding member of Balsam Range. He sings lead and tenor harmony, and his distinctive voice and artistry are instantly recognizable and widely admired. Tony Rice described him as having “one of the most exciting and purest voices I have ever heard….” He keeps up a busy performance schedule, playing for many events throughout the region with Balsam Range, solo, and with other great Western North Carolina artists.
Daren Shumaker is an exceptional mandolin player who has performed on Saturday Night Live with Chris Stapleton and at the Grand Old Opry with Del McCoury. He’s spent most of his career as a live sound engineer for the likes of Sam Bush, Steep Canyon Rangers, Del McCoury, and Chris Stapleton but is now stepping onto the stage more often.
Painter and musician Shannon Whitworth is an incredible talent! In the early 2000s, Whitworth toured and recorded with the iconic bluegrass band, The Biscuit Burners, sharing lead vocals and playing the guitar and banjo. After two critically acclaimed albums with the band, Whitworth released three solo albums and a duet album. Whitworth is a multi-instrumentalist and songwriter and often performs with her husband, Woody Platt.

THE FISHING: Baja Mexico’s East Cape is one of the world’s most productive bluewater fly fishing locations. Gentle seas, fair weather, and a precipitous nearby drop-off to the ocean floor make this the perfect setting for fly and conventional fishing. Add the incredible number of migrating pelagic and resident species, and you have a recipe for some incredible angling action. The typical fishing day begins and ends in front of the property. A normal fishing day starts with breakfast served at 6:00 AM in the restaurant or brought on board and enjoyed on the boat. The guides arrive on the beach at 6:30 AM, and guests board pangas right in front of the villas. There is incredible inshore fishing for roosterfish, jacks, ladyfish, giant needlefish, pompano, and other species that cruise the beach in search of prey. Fishing from the beach is almost always a sight fishing game. Anglers walk the beach with the guide in search of cruising fish. When fish are spotted, anglers often run to get into the casting position. It is a unique blend of sight-fishing, casting, walking, and chaos. When fishing from the panga (the typical 23-foot Mexican fishing boat), live bait is often used to bring fish within casting range, or the guides use a teaser on a spinning rod. The action is fast and furious with either a fly rod or a conventional spinning rod.
NON-ANGLING ACTIVITIES: Situated at one end of the bay, guests have excellent swimming and snorkeling opportunities directly in front of the resort property. Kayaks and stand-up boards are provided for guest use. The property has numerous pools at guests’ disposal, including a waterfall/plunge pool for the adventurous. The Sea of Cortez is one of the most abundant marine environments in the world, and day trips to explore the local sea life can easily be arranged. Whales, dolphins, turtles, and sea lions are frequent visitors. Guests can also arrange to take an excursion to tour, shop or play golf in nearby La Paz, approximately one hour from the resort. Other activities include yoga, guided snorkeling adventures, full spa services, Mexican cooking classes, golfing, hiking, and more.
